The Lobbying Competition enables companies and professional or charitable organizations to submit real lobbying subjects to masters students in Public Affairs or Competitive Intelligence.

The Lobbying Competition  2020Organized by Spin Partners since 2001, the Competition helps to reinforce the visibility of an ethical lobbying between public authorities and interest groups.


It is sponsored each year by a French or European parliamentarian, who shares his vision of lobbying with the students and institutional relations professionals participating in the Competition.


The interests of the Competition for partners (companies, federations, NGOs…):


– Having four or five dossiers (one per master participant), each including a study of the context and the actors involved, then a deepening of the problem, and finally specific recommendations,


– Benefiting from a diversity of points of view on your subjects,


– Considering new lobbying strategies,


– Communicating publicly about your commitment to transparent lobbying.


The Competition calendar:


From October to December 2019, the partners of the Competition work out a lobbying problem, in consultation with the organizers. Five partners are selected to submit their topics to the students.


Between January and May 2020, the students of the five participating masters (Institute for Political Studies, Universities, Business Schools) meet with the representatives of the partners and prepare their analysis and operational proposals.


Between May and June 2020, student dossiers are evaluated by a jury composed of representatives of the partners and external public affairs professionals.


At the end of June 2020, an award ceremony is held in the presence of the Parliamentary Sponsor of the Competition, as well as other politicians, lobbyists and journalists.
